Laser,
Was bid 15K on my June 05 21K miles in January, when I bought an 04 M3 at BM main dealer, without any haggling and the M was cheaper than most on the BM network ( its got all the toys and right colour and low miles etc) so it was not a dog they were desperate to sell.
I have a high spec except crapnav, DSG, Leather, Monzas, Xenons,Cruise, Perimeter, full multifunction, Steel Grey, OEM detach towbar, 6CD etc etc.
The 15K was a straight telephone bid from a VW dealer in South London to the BM dealer whilst I was there.
In the end kept the GTI for the missus and chopped in 5 series we had.
But it's straight supply and demand, the roads are full of GTI's so are VW dealers, just do a national search, and although they will be much better than say the Ford or Vauxhall, there is so much buyer choice, the great resales I think are past us now, so if you recover say 50% on a 3 year old then its been fair motoring in my book, but it is always skewed by what you are buying, dealer incentives, time of the month, moon phase etc.
